How they compare

Bahamas currently reports 0.4794 units per US$ of GDP against 0.4718 units per US$ of GDP in Jordan, a difference of 0.0076 units per US$ of GDP.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 48 shared years of data; in 1969 it was Bahamas ahead.

Bahamas ranks 161st and Jordan ranks 163rd of 174 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Bahamas averaged higher in 4 and Jordan in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bahamas Jordan Difference Ahead
1960s 0.5996 units per US$ of GDP 0.0622 units per US$ of GDP 0.5374 units per US$ of GDP Bahamas
1970s 0.4396 units per US$ of GDP 0.0864 units per US$ of GDP 0.3532 units per US$ of GDP Bahamas
1980s 0.29 units per US$ of GDP 0.2154 units per US$ of GDP 0.0745 units per US$ of GDP Bahamas
1990s 0.4318 units per US$ of GDP 0.4556 units per US$ of GDP 0.0238 units per US$ of GDP Jordan
2000s 0.514 units per US$ of GDP 0.5477 units per US$ of GDP 0.0336 units per US$ of GDP Jordan
2010s 0.5971 units per US$ of GDP 0.4549 units per US$ of GDP 0.1422 units per US$ of GDP Bahamas

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
